Nu er det blevet testet, om iPhones bliver langsommere med tiden

Nej, din iPhone er ikke bygget til at blive langsommere med tiden - men alligevel kan den godt føles tungere at danse med.

Det er blevet påstået, at Apple med vilje gør gamle iPhone-modeller langsommere for at presse folk til at købe selskabets nyeste modeller. Men er det sandt?

Nu har selskabet Futuremark sammenlignet flere end 100.000 ydelsesmålinger for syv forskellige iPhone-modeller på tværs af tre forskellige versioner af iOS. Futuremark laver software, som måler ydelsen i mobiltelefoner, og står bl.a. bag testprogrammet 3DMark, som bruges af rigtig mange medier til ydelsestests.

3DMark-versionen, som er blevet benyttet, hedder Slingshot Extreme og sætter telefonenerne på en rimelig hård prøve ved at køre en række CPU- og GPU-intensive ydelsestests. Testprogrammet findes både til iOS og Android.

Ingen tegn på, at telefonerne bliver langsommere

Ifølge ydelsestestene fra Futuremark er der intet, der tyder på, at Apple med vilje gør gamle iPhone-modeller langsommere over tid.

Selskabet så først på ydelsestallene for iPhone 5S fra april 2016 og frem til september i år. I løbet af perioden blev telefonerne opgraderet først fra iOS 9 til iOS 10 og for nylig til iOS 11.

Målingerne for både GPU-ydelse og CPU-ydelse viste sig at være forholdsvis konsistente over tid – og iOS-opgraderingerne havde ingen signifikant indvirkning på telefonens ydelse.

GPU-ydelsen for iPhone 5S ved tre forskellige iOS-versioner. iOS 11 er i orange, iOS 10 i blåt, iOS 9 i gråt. (Illustration: Futuremark)

Heller ikke ydelsesmålingerne for iPhone 6, 6S og 7 viste nogen nævneværdig ændring i ydelsen over tid, ej heller ved opgraderinger til nye iOS-versioner.

GPU-ydelsen holdt sig ganske stabil, mens grafen for CPU-ydelse viser en svag reduktion over tid – muligvis på grund af små iOS-opdateringer eller andre faktorer.

Men ændringerne er så små, at Futuremark anser det for usandsynligt, at brugerne vil mærke det.

CPU-ydelsen for iPhone 5S ved tre forskellige iOS-versioner. iOS 11 er i orange, iOS 10 i blåt, iOS 9 i gråt. (Illustration: Futuremark)

Så hvorfor mener vi, at gamle iPhones bliver langsommere?

»Vore ydelsestests viser, at frem for bevidst at forringe ydelsen i gamle modeller gør Apple faktisk et godt stykke arbejde for at understøtte gamle modeller med jævnlige opdateringer. De gør, at der holdes et konstant ydelsesniveau på tværs af iOS-versioner,« skriver Futuremark.

Selskabet udelukker imidlertid ikke, at der er faktorer, som gør, at vi føler, at gamle telefoner bliver langsommere over tid.

Den ene faktor er den psykologiske effekt - at man ved, at der findes en hurtigere og bedre model, og at det i sig selv kan gøre, at ens egen model føles forældet.

En anden – og lige så reel – er, at nye iOS-versioner kan have nye funktioner, som bruger flere ressourcer og kræver mere processorkraft. Noget af skylden ligger også hos app-udviklerne.

Dem, som udvikler apps, optimerer dem gerne til de nyeste iPhone-modeller, og appsene kører derfor måske ikke lige så godt på telefoner med ældre hardware.

Det kan også være, at apps udviklet til tidligere versioner af iOS ikke udnytter optimeringer, som er lavet i nyere iOS-versioner.

Overblikket. (Illustration: Futuremark)

Denne artikel stammer fra norske digi.no.

Tips og korrekturforslag til denne historie sendes til tip@version2.dk
Følg forløbet
Kommentarer (8)
Bjarke Rodas

Jeg tror det er de færreste, der tror, at hardwaren bliver langsommere med en ny OS release. Det er vel det, de har undersøgt i testen? At transistorerne ikke fordærves. Det typiske problem er i almindelig brug hvor ting pludseligt tager mærkbart længere. Fx gik min iPhone 5 fra fuldt ud anvendelig til hyppig 10 sekunders frysning ved dens sidste opdatering.

Baldur Norddahl

Jeg har ikke iPhone så kan ikke udtale mig om det brand. Men min Google Nexus 9 tablet bliver langsommere. Det er et kendt problem som kan fikses ved at formatere filsystemet. Det kan gøres i en særlig boot mode. Bagefter er den så god som ny.

Antagelig er det noget i stil med fragmentering der er problemet. Et andet problem kan være at brugeren med tiden simpelthen har fået hentet for mange skidt apps.

Christoffer Kelm Kjeldgaard

Jeg giver ikke meget for benchmark programmer. Telefonproducenter er før blevet taget i at detektere programmerne og tildele dem ekstra systemressourcer normalt reserveret til systemet / afvikle disk benchmark i virtuelt oprettede RAM drev til formålet. Det eneste der virker er comparison tests ved normal brug. Se flere. Eks. Denne http://www.redmondpie.com/ios-11-beta-1-vs-ios-10.3.2-benchmarks-speed-p... hvor telefonen tydeligt i visse brugsscenarier er langsommere - i kameraapplikationen er det endda meget tydeligt at der er forskel. En konspirationstænker vil sige, at det er fordi ingen gider at vente på kameraet fordi det bruges i situationer hvor reaktionsevnen på telefonen er vigtig. Derfor påvirkes kunden ubevidst til at udskifte telefonen med en nyere model.

Magnus Jørgensen

Det faktum at man nemt kan gøre selve operativ systemets menuer og grafiske overflade langsommere uden at det går ud over det enkelte program, gør at denne analyse er totalt ubrugelig.
Hvis man skulle lave en relevant analyse skulle de lave test af operativ systemets brugergrænsefladen og ikke en test af en app.

Martin Sørensen

Ja, dem der har lavet undersøgelsen har da helt misforstået problematikken.

Selvfølgeligt bliver CPU, GPU osv. ikke objektivt langsommere hvilket er hvad de tester her, men pga. nye features bliver operativsystemet typisk større og tungere hvilket gør brugerfladen sløvere efter en opgradering.

Min Commodore 64 kører også præcist lige så hurtigt som da jeg fik den i 1986 (mere eller mindre dikteret af CPU clocken på 985.248 Hz), men jeg skal nok ikke gøre mig de store forhåbninger om at køre et moderne operativsystem på den, selv om vi for en kort stund antog at den rent faktisk havde tilstrækkelig hukommelse til det. :-)

Heini Lindenskov Samuelsen

Hvis du kigger på graferne, vil du se at de har testet med tre forskellige iOS-versioner; iOS 9, 10 og 11. Dermed er det altså ikke kun hardware der er blevet testet, men styresystem også.

Derudover er det ikke resultater fra deres egen laboratorietest der er tale om, men derimod over 100.000 benchmark resultater fra 'rigtige' iPhones i real-world brug.

Link til den originale artikel: https://www.futuremark.com/pressreleases/is-it-true-that-iphones-get-slo...

Bjarke Rodas

Selvfølgelig har de testet igennem styresystemets API, men CPU eller GPU micro benchmark giver intet som helst billede af den reelle brugeroplevelse. Det er ren manipulation / sensations-opsøgning at konkludere som de gør. Det eneste benchmark der fungerer for at give et billede af om en telefon føles langsom er på applikations niveau. Fx ved at tage tid på hvor lang tid det tager inden bestemte apps er brugbare.

Christoffer Kelm Kjeldgaard

Hej Heini,

Der er ikke tale om test af brugsscenarier, men om hvorvidt en iPhone / iPad har samme ydelse i programmer, der f. eks. tester hvor hurtigt data kan læses / skrives til RAM, CPUens registre, grafikchippens ydelse - og så videre. Det ville sådan set være en fin parameter for reel ydelse i brug, hvis altså ikke det var fordi producenten detekterer softwaren og tildeler det ekstra systemressourcer, sådan at ydelsesforskellen på tværs af operativsystemversioner bliver ubetydelig. Jeg vil nærmere sige, at hestens resultater netop underbygger indignationen for at der er fiflet med tallene. Aldrig har jeg set så pæn, næsten vandret, lineær en kurve når der er tale om flere større opdateringer. Enten er Apple bare verdens bedste til at få "gratis" ydelse ved introduktionen af nye features, eller også er der ugler i mosen - hvilket forstærkes af at der er rigtigt mange brugsscenarietests der ikke korrelerer med disse testresultater. Jeg har faktisk ikke kunnet finde en der underbygger artiklens resultater her.

Log ind eller Opret konto for at kommentere
Pressemeddelelser

Silicom i Søborg har fået stærk vind i sejlene…

Silicom Denmark arbejder med cutting-edge teknologier og er helt fremme hvad angår FPGA teknologien, som har eksisteret i over 20 år.
22. sep 2017

Conference: How AI and Machine Learning can accelerate your business growth

Can Artificial Intelligence (AI) and Machine Learning bring actual value to your business? Will it supercharge growth? How do other businesses leverage AI and Machine Learning?
13. sep 2017

Affecto has the solution and the tools you need

According to GDPR, you are required to be in control of all of your personally identifiable and sensitive data. There are only a few software tools on the market to support this requirement today.
13. sep 2017